Output 921ef56c9bf0d7869f7bf3a8a75782d5af4981933e858e8ba049a1f03c2c63ec:9

value
294378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 642bd3178bd477ab6daf2f1d64d5fb4bcfb46bfd OP_EQUAL
address
3ApfziEx5CBvNRcb7p7qwwJJeSHBHGVHUQ
transaction
921ef56c9bf0d7869f7bf3a8a75782d5af4981933e858e8ba049a1f03c2c63ec
confirmations
234175
spent
true